イーサリアムアップデートの詳細と影響を解説
イーサリアムは、ビットコインに次ぐ時価総額を誇る主要な暗号資産であり、分散型アプリケーション(DApps)やスマートコントラクトの基盤として広く利用されています。その進化は常に進行しており、ネットワークの性能向上、セキュリティ強化、スケーラビリティ問題の解決を目指した様々なアップデートが実施されてきました。本稿では、イーサリアムの主要なアップデートについて詳細に解説し、それらが及ぼす影響について考察します。
1. イーサリアムの基礎とアップデートの必要性
イーサリアムは、2015年にヴィタリック・ブテリンによって提唱された分散型プラットフォームです。ビットコインと同様にブロックチェーン技術を基盤としていますが、ビットコインが主に価値の保存手段としての役割を担うのに対し、イーサリアムはより汎用的なプラットフォームとして設計されています。これにより、金融、サプライチェーン管理、投票システムなど、様々な分野での応用が期待されています。
しかし、イーサリアムは当初からスケーラビリティ問題に直面していました。トランザクション処理能力が低いため、ネットワークが混雑するとトランザクション手数料が高騰し、処理速度が遅延するという課題がありました。また、プルーフ・オブ・ワーク(PoW)というコンセンサスアルゴリズムを採用していたため、消費電力の高さも問題視されていました。これらの課題を解決するために、イーサリアムの開発チームは、様々なアップデートを計画・実施してきました。
2. 主要なアップデートの概要
2.1. Byzantium (ビザンティウム)
2017年10月に実施されたByzantiumアップデートは、イーサリアムの仮想マシン(EVM)の改善とセキュリティ強化を目的としていました。このアップデートにより、スマートコントラクトの実行効率が向上し、ガス代の削減が実現しました。また、EIP-155などの提案が導入され、replay攻撃に対する保護が強化されました。
2.2. Constantinople (コンスタンティノープル)
2019年2月に実施されたConstantinopleアップデートは、EVMのさらなる改善と、ガス代の削減に焦点を当てました。EIP-1283などの提案が導入され、スマートコントラクトの実行コストが削減され、開発者の負担が軽減されました。また、このアップデートは、今後のアップデートに向けた基盤整備としての役割も担っていました。
2.3. Istanbul (イスタンブール)
2019年12月に実施されたIstanbulアップデートは、プライバシー保護機能の強化と、EVMの最適化を目的としていました。EIP-1451などの提案が導入され、スマートコントラクトのコードサイズが削減され、ガス代の削減が実現しました。また、このアップデートは、zk-SNARKsなどのプライバシー保護技術の導入に向けた準備段階としての役割も担っていました。
2.4. Berlin (ベルリン)
2021年4月に実施されたBerlinアップデートは、ガス代の削減と、EVMの最適化に焦点を当てました。EIP-2929などの提案が導入され、スマートコントラクトの実行コストが削減され、開発者の負担が軽減されました。また、このアップデートは、今後のThe Mergeに向けた準備段階としての役割も担っていました。
2.5. The Merge (ザ・マージ)
2022年9月に実施されたThe Mergeは、イーサリアムの歴史において最も重要なアップデートの一つです。このアップデートにより、イーサリアムはプルーフ・オブ・ワーク(PoW)からプルーフ・オブ・ステーク(PoS)へのコンセンサスアルゴリズムの移行を完了しました。これにより、イーサリアムの消費電力が大幅に削減され、環境負荷が軽減されました。また、PoSはPoWよりもセキュリティが高いとされており、ネットワークの安全性が向上しました。The Mergeは、イーサリアムのスケーラビリティ問題の解決に向けた重要な一歩となりました。
2.6. Shanghai (上海)
2023年4月に実施されたShanghaiアップデートは、The Mergeによって導入されたステークされたETHの引き出しを可能にするアップデートです。これにより、バリデーターはステークしたETHを引き出すことができ、流動性が向上しました。また、このアップデートは、イーサリアムの経済モデルの改善にも貢献しています。
3. アップデートが及ぼす影響
3.1. スケーラビリティの向上
The MergeによるPoSへの移行は、イーサリアムのスケーラビリティ向上に大きく貢献しています。PoSはPoWよりもトランザクション処理能力が高く、ネットワークの混雑を緩和することができます。また、今後のLayer 2ソリューションとの組み合わせにより、イーサリアムのスケーラビリティはさらに向上すると期待されています。
3.2. セキュリティの強化
PoSはPoWよりもセキュリティが高いとされており、ネットワークの安全性が向上しました。PoSでは、攻撃者がネットワークを支配するためには、ネットワーク全体のステークされたETHの過半数を所有する必要があり、そのコストが非常に高いため、攻撃が困難になります。
3.3. 環境負荷の軽減
The MergeによるPoSへの移行は、イーサリアムの消費電力を大幅に削減し、環境負荷を軽減しました。PoWでは、トランザクションを検証するために大量の電力を消費する必要がありましたが、PoSでは、電力消費量が大幅に削減されます。
3.4. DeFiへの影響
イーサリアムのアップデートは、DeFi(分散型金融)エコシステムにも大きな影響を与えています。スケーラビリティの向上とガス代の削減により、DeFiアプリケーションの利用が容易になり、より多くのユーザーがDeFiに参加できるようになります。また、セキュリティの強化により、DeFiアプリケーションの安全性が向上し、ユーザーの資産が保護されます。
3.5. NFTへの影響
イーサリアムのアップデートは、NFT(非代替性トークン)エコシステムにも影響を与えています。スケーラビリティの向上とガス代の削減により、NFTの取引が容易になり、より多くのユーザーがNFTに参加できるようになります。また、セキュリティの強化により、NFTの安全性が向上し、ユーザーの資産が保護されます。
4. 今後の展望
イーサリアムの開発チームは、今後も様々なアップデートを計画しています。主なものとしては、以下のものが挙げられます。
- Dencun: ガス代の削減と、EVMの最適化を目的としたアップデート。
- Proto-Danksharding: スケーラビリティを大幅に向上させることを目的としたアップデート。
- Verkle Trees: イーサリアムのデータ構造を改善し、ノードのストレージ要件を削減することを目的としたアップデート。
これらのアップデートにより、イーサリアムは、より高性能で、より安全で、よりスケーラブルなプラットフォームへと進化していくと期待されています。
5. まとめ
イーサリアムは、その進化を続けることで、分散型アプリケーションやスマートコントラクトの基盤として、ますます重要な役割を担っていくでしょう。The Mergeを成功させたことは、その進化の大きな一歩であり、今後のアップデートによって、イーサリアムは、より多くの分野で活用される可能性を秘めています。スケーラビリティ、セキュリティ、環境負荷といった課題に対する継続的な取り組みは、イーサリアムの持続的な成長と発展に不可欠です。イーサリアムのアップデートは、暗号資産業界全体にも大きな影響を与え、分散型Webの実現を加速させる原動力となるでしょう。